Output 306588ce94219b6675fe291ef914298b040861ec612443707f41f49e215662d2:0

value
131713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b04d19f9804db984b0184e85c7ec05a3e22c29c2 OP_EQUAL
address
3HmDDQhoMY6MQH9Bz7gmaChY46WaRQrxPc
transaction
306588ce94219b6675fe291ef914298b040861ec612443707f41f49e215662d2
spent
true